import React from 'react' export default class App extends React.Component { constructor(props) { super() this.state = { prints: [] } fetch('/_services/awprint/index') .then( res => { return res.json() }).then( prints => { this.setState({ prints }) }).catch( e => { console.error(e) }) } render() { const prints = this.state.prints.map( (print,i) => { const className = print.printed ? 'print printed' : 'print' const date = print.date.replace(/T/,' - ').replace(/:\d\d\..*/,'') return (
this.print(print)}>
{date}
) }) return (
{prints}
) } }